引言
随着科技的飞速发展,增强现实(AR)技术逐渐成为人们关注的焦点。九音AR作为一家专注于AR技术研发和应用的企业,其创新科技正在重塑我们的互动体验。本文将深入探讨九音AR的技术原理、应用场景及其对未来互动体验的影响。
九音AR技术原理
1. 感知与定位
九音AR技术首先依赖于高精度的传感器和摄像头,实现对周围环境的感知。通过分析图像、声音和空间数据,AR系统可以准确地定位用户的位置和姿态。
import cv2
# 假设已经加载了摄像头
cap = cv2.VideoCapture(0)
while True:
ret, frame = cap.read()
if not ret:
break
# 处理图像,进行定位
# ...
cv2.imshow('AR View', frame)
if cv2.waitKey(1) & 0xFF == ord('q'):
break
cap.release()
cv2.destroyAllWindows()
2. 数据融合与处理
在感知与定位的基础上,九音AR技术通过数据融合算法,将来自不同传感器的信息进行整合,形成统一的虚拟与现实交互环境。
import numpy as np
# 假设sensor_data为来自不同传感器的数据
sensor_data = np.random.rand(10, 5)
# 数据融合算法
def data_fusion(sensor_data):
# ...
return fused_data
fused_data = data_fusion(sensor_data)
3. 虚拟物体渲染
九音AR技术通过计算机图形学技术,将虚拟物体渲染到现实场景中。这一过程涉及光线追踪、阴影处理和纹理映射等技术。
import pygame
# 初始化pygame
pygame.init()
# 创建窗口
screen = pygame.display.set_mode((800, 600))
# 渲染虚拟物体
def render_virtual_object(screen, object):
# ...
while True:
for event in pygame.event.get():
if event.type == pygame.QUIT:
pygame.quit()
exit()
# 渲染场景
render_virtual_object(screen, object)
pygame.display.flip()
九音AR应用场景
1. 教育领域
九音AR技术可以应用于教育领域,通过虚拟实验和互动教学,提高学生的学习兴趣和效果。
2. 游戏娱乐
在游戏娱乐领域,九音AR技术可以实现沉浸式游戏体验,让玩家在虚拟世界中畅游。
3. 商业展示
九音AR技术可以应用于商业展示,通过虚拟产品展示和互动体验,提升品牌形象和销售业绩。
未来展望
随着九音AR技术的不断发展,未来互动体验将更加丰富和多样化。以下是一些可能的趋势:
1. 跨平台融合
九音AR技术将与其他平台(如虚拟现实、物联网等)进行融合,形成更加完善的互动生态系统。
2. 个性化定制
根据用户需求,九音AR技术将提供更加个性化的互动体验。
3. 社会应用
九音AR技术将在社会应用领域发挥重要作用,如城市规划、医疗健康等。
总之,九音AR技术正在重塑我们的互动体验,为未来生活带来更多可能性。